Description<br />

Chillers are temperature control devices that ideally are used for carry<strong>in</strong>g away of<br />

process heat and as economic alternative for cool<strong>in</strong>g water (dr<strong>in</strong>k<strong>in</strong>g water) i.e. for a<br />

reflux condenser, condensers, tools,…<br />

Due to high refrigeration performance a very short cool<strong>in</strong>g time can be achieved.<br />

A pump is responsible for a good circulation of the thermal fluid.<br />

For Chillers with a pump that can build pressure up to 2,5 bar, supply l<strong>in</strong>e pressure can<br />

be set by means of a VPC-Bypass and thus can be adapted for the required application.<br />

The pressure of the supply l<strong>in</strong>e is <strong>in</strong>dicated via a manometer display.<br />

Temperatures can be easily red via the LED-display screen.<br />

An easy keypad (set-po<strong>in</strong>t, arrow up and arrow down key) is used to set a set-po<strong>in</strong>t.<br />

Thermostats uses an over-temperature protection <strong>in</strong> accordance with DIN EN 61010-2-<br />

010, which is <strong>in</strong>dependent of the actual control circuits (only valid for units with<br />

heat<strong>in</strong>g)<br />
